Brazilian folk dance and folk drama
are rick forms of popular artistic expression. Subject, rhythm, costume,
and choreography revealthe three principal components of the nation's
culture in a complex interaction.
There are dozens of Brazilian folk
dances - everything from dramatizations of the early
wars between the Portuguese and the Indians (Caboclinhos and Caiapós performed
inthe states of Pernambuco and Alagoas), to the Cavalhada of Pirenópolis
in the state of Goiás, a theatrical pageant, lasting threedays,
which depicts the fight between the Christians and
the Moors on the Iberian Peninsula. The Cavalhada survives from thetradition
of medieval
tournaments.
